Indoor Air Detection Equipment Market

Overview

The Indoor Air Detection Equipment market is witnessing significant growth as concerns about indoor air quality (IAQ) and its impact on human health continue to rise. Indoor air pollution, caused by volatile organic compounds (VOCs), carbon monoxide, carbon dioxide, particulate matter, mold spores, and other contaminants, has been linked to respiratory diseases, allergies, and reduced productivity. Indoor air detection equipment plays a critical role in monitoring these pollutants in real time, enabling better air management in residential, commercial, industrial, and healthcare facilities. Growing awareness of “sick building syndrome” and the importance of healthy indoor environments is driving global adoption.

Market Size and Growth

The global Indoor Air Detection Equipment market was valued at USD 4.2 billion in 2024 and is projected to reach USD 7.9 billion by 2033, expanding at a CAGR of 7.2% during the forecast period. Market expansion is being fueled by stricter building regulations, growing demand for smart home solutions, and rising adoption of IoT-enabled air quality monitoring devices.

Key Drivers

  1. Rising Health Awareness – Increasing cases of asthma, respiratory allergies, and chronic obstructive pulmonary disease (COPD) caused by poor indoor air quality are boosting demand for air detection systems.
  2. Government Regulations and Standards – Regulatory frameworks such as OSHA standards in the U.S. and Europe’s Indoor Air Quality directives mandate regular monitoring in workplaces and public spaces.
  3. Smart Building and Home Automation Growth – Integration of indoor air detectors into smart HVAC systems and IoT-based platforms enhances energy efficiency and comfort.
  4. Post-Pandemic Concerns – COVID-19 heightened awareness of indoor ventilation and air quality, driving demand for continuous monitoring solutions.

Restraints

While opportunities are strong, a few factors challenge market growth:

  • High Costs of Advanced Systems – Multi-parameter detection systems with IoT connectivity can be expensive for residential users.
  • Data Management Issues – Large volumes of real-time monitoring data require efficient analytics platforms.
  • Lack of Awareness in Developing Regions – Many households and small enterprises remain unaware of the long-term risks of poor IAQ.

Segmentation

The Indoor Air Detection Equipment market can be segmented into:

  • By Product Type: Fixed indoor air detectors, portable air detectors, and smart/IoT-enabled detectors.
  • By Pollutant Type: VOCs, particulate matter (PM2.5, PM10), carbon dioxide, carbon monoxide, radon, and others.
  • By End Use: Residential, commercial (offices, malls, schools, hospitality), industrial, and healthcare facilities.

Regional Insights

  • North America: Leads the market due to high awareness, strict air quality standards, and growing adoption of smart building technologies.
  • Europe: Strong focus on sustainability, energy-efficient buildings, and indoor workplace safety regulations is driving adoption.
  • Asia-Pacific: Expected to grow at the fastest pace, driven by urbanization, rising pollution levels in China and India, and demand for healthier residential and office spaces.
  • Latin America & Middle East & Africa: Gradual adoption is expected, supported by increasing infrastructure development and growing health concerns.

Opportunities

  • Development of low-cost portable detectors to penetrate household and small-business segments.
  • Integration with AI and predictive analytics for proactive indoor air management.
  • Rising demand for indoor air detection as a service in large commercial and industrial facilities.
  • Expansion into smart city projects, where IAQ monitoring is part of sustainable infrastructure.
